CN2 (China Next Generation Internet) is a next-generation Internet architecture launched by China Telecom. Its core is to improve network quality and user experience. Singapore's CN2 network optimization technology is optimized based on CN2 and aims to provide users with faster and more stable network connections. This technology effectively reduces network congestion and improves the efficiency of data transmission through intelligent routing, traffic management, and delay control.
Singapore's CN2 network optimization technology has a number of significant advantages. First, its low-latency features enable delay-sensitive applications such as online games and video conferencing to run smoothly. Secondly, stable network connections ensure the security of enterprises during data transmission and reduce the risk of information loss. In addition, the intelligent routing of CN2 technology can dynamically adjust the data transmission path according to network conditions, thereby achieving more efficient resource utilization.
